Focusing on the political condition of modern man, this analysis delves into Aleksandr Solzhenitsyn's significant critique of communist totalitarianism. Daniel Mahoney highlights the often-overlooked influence of Solzhenitsyn's work on twentieth-century thought, blending Western and Russian philosophies alongside Christian and classical wisdom. The book offers a unique philosophical perspective, shedding light on the profound impact of Solzhenitsyn's writing and its relevance in contemporary discussions on freedom and morality.
